2023年最新区块链游戏视频
2025-11-28
在过去的几年里,区块链技术迅速发展,已经被广泛应用于金融、供应链、物联网等多个领域。然而,随着应用场景的增加,如何有效地区块链的性能,以满足不断增长的需求,成为了研究者和开发者面临的重要挑战。本文将围绕“区块链调优”的最新消息展开讨论,分析现有调优方法的优缺点,并提供最佳实践,以推动区块链技术的进一步发展。
区块链技术的设计初衷是提供一个去中心化、高安全性的分布式账本。然而,在实际应用中,许多区块链面临着性能瓶颈,包括交易处理速度慢、能耗高、存储空间不足等问题。这些问题直接影响了区块链技术的普及,尤其是在需要高频交易、实时数据更新的场景下。因此,区块链调优显得尤为必要。
调优的挑战主要体现在以下几个方面:
区块链调优的方法多种多样,主要包括以下几类:
为实现有效的区块链调优,以下是一些最佳实践:
随着区块链技术的不断发展,调优方案也在不断演进。未来,我们可以预计以下趋势:
在区块链技术的应用中,能源消耗是一个突出的议题,尤其是使用工作量证明(PoW)机制的区块链。调优策略如果不考虑能源效益,虽能够提高交易速度,但可能导致更高的能耗,进而影响整个系统的可持续性。
首先,PoW共识机制的能耗问题已引起了科研界和工业界的广泛关注。作为一种高计算成本的机制,PoW需要消耗大量电力,这使得一些区块链项目面临环保压力。调优时,可以考虑实现能源使用效率的最大化,例如,改用权益证明(PoS)等更致力于资源节约的共识机制,这能够降低整体的能耗。
其次,在调优过程中,设计的矿工激励机制也尤为重要。合理的激励机制可以促使矿工进行更为节能的挖矿活动。此外,鼓励社区开发绿色矿场、使用可再生能源等策略,同样是一种可行的调优方向。
最后,开发透明的能耗监测工具也是十分必要的。通过实时监测区块链网络的能耗,可以发现潜在的调优空间,并实现对能耗的动态管理,从而在保证性能的基础上,降低能耗,达到可持续发展的目标。
区块链网络的共识机制是决定其性能、效率和安全性的重要因素。常见的共识机制主要有工作量证明(PoW)、权益证明(PoS)、委托权益证明(DPoS)、实用拜占庭容错(PBFT)等。
首先,工作量证明(PoW)虽然安全性高,但能耗大,交易速度慢,且不易扩展,而权益证明(PoS)通过减少计算能力的消耗,提升了交易效率,降低了能耗。调优策略中,可以考虑在区块链实施初期采用PoW,以确保网络的去中心化和安全性,而在网络成熟后进行渐进切换到PoS机制,以提升整体性能和安全性。
其次,委托权益证明(DPoS)具备更高的效率和可扩展性,允许网络参与者通过选举代表来维护网络,调优策略在于合理设计节点的选举机制和激励机制,确保网络的去中心化与高效运作。
最后,实用拜占庭容错(PBFT)在小规模网络中表现优异,适合企业内部隐私保护较强的应用场景。调优时需要关注其通信复杂度,适当减少参与节点数量以提高性能。
不同的共识机制在调优上各有侧重,项目团队要综合考虑应用需求、网络规模、用户量等因素,选择适合的共识机制进行调优,以实现最佳性能。
交易处理速度是影响区块链系统性能的关键指标之一。提高交易处理速度的途径主要包括共识机制、区块大小与时间调整、网络协议改进等。
首先,共识机制是直接提高交易处理速度的方式。通过选择适合的共识机制,例如权益证明(PoS)相较于工作量证明(PoW)能显著提高交易确认速度。在某些情况下,可以结合多种共识机制,采用混合模式,以充分发挥各自优势。
其次,调整区块大小与生成时间同样会影响交易处理速度。一般来说,增加区块大小与缩短生成时间能够提高每秒处理的交易数量。然而,这也伴随着网络节点的负担增加,需要在性能和安全性之间找到平衡.
此外,对于限于网络带宽和延迟的情况,网络协议至为关键。采用更高效的数据传输协议、块传输合并等方式来减少延迟,是一种行之有效的策略。拓展连接速度和容量也能减少整体交易确认时间。
最后,采用分层架构或侧链技术将会显著提升处理性能。通过将一部分交易放在侧链上进行验证,大幅减轻主链的工作负担。最终,团队还需进行持续的监测与调优,以适应不断变化的业务需求。
随着区块链技术逐渐应用于金融、医疗等敏感领域,数据隐私的保护显得愈加重要。然而,区块链技术的透明性与去中心化特性往往与数据隐私相悖,因此在调优时须谨慎处理。
首先,数据隐私保护技术如零知识证明(ZKP)、同态加密等正在成为解决方案的关键。其中,零知识证明允许数据在不公开本身的情况下,进行有效的验证,调优时可在确保数据真实性的前提下,提高隐私保护水平。
其次,结合分布式身份识别(DID)技术,区块链可以让用户对自身数据拥有一定的控制权。在保障交易与账户安全的同时,用户可主动选择共享某些信息,进一步提升隐私保护能力。
然而,在实际操作中,对于隐私保护与区块链性能的权衡成为核心问题。更复杂的加密技术虽然提升了隐私保护水平,但无形中增加了存储和计算成本。因此,在调优策略中制定重视隐私保护与性能兼容的设计方案会颇具挑战。
最后,法规合规也是隐私保护的重要构成,尤其在GDPR法规日益严苛的背景下,开发者需考虑合规性,明确在调优过程中的数据保护策略,以防止法律风险。
智能合约是区块链应用的重要组成部分,其性能直接关系到整个系统的效率。因此,针对智能合约的调优也是区块链调优的重要环节。
首先,在智能合约开发过程中,应充分考虑协议设计与代码质量。建议开发者采用设计模式、审查代码及进行单元测试,以确保高质量代码的编写。
其次,合约的执行会消耗gas费用,因此合约逻辑、减少不必要的计算及存储操作能够有效降低执行成本。使用事件记录机制替代状态变量以节省存储成本、合理使用循环结构和条件判断,也是常见的最佳实践。
另外,避免长时间运行的合约是必要的,不应让合约处理复杂的逻辑。复杂逻辑可以通过多合约拆分实现,由多个合约协作完成的设计,无论是在安全性还是在计算效率上都会有良好的效果。
最后,监测与更新亦不可或缺。执行过程中应评估合约的性能指标,并结合实际情况进行动态调整。智能合约标准的更新与也能不断提升其执行效率。
综上所述,区块链的调优是一个复杂且多面向的过程,需结合多种技术和实践,才能有效提升性能,满足应用需求和保持可持续性。不断推进区块链调优研究与实践,将为未来的数字社会提供更强大的技术支撑。